Why CISOs Should Care
Secure Trust Technologies is the vehicle used by i-Sprint's existing management team, in strategic partnership with KV Asia Capital, to complete a management buy-out of i-Sprint's operating companies, establishing an independent, large IAM/Quantum-Safe/Mobile cybersecurity provider in Asia.
What Makes It Different
Rather than a strategic-buyer acquisition, this preserves i-Sprint's existing management continuity and product direction while adding KV Asia Capital's growth capital and independence from any prior parent structure.
